HDD Regenerator is a unique utility designed to recover damaged sectors on a hard drive. Unlike standard disk repair tools (like chkdsk in Windows) that simply mark bad sectors as "bad" and hide them from the operating system, HDD Regenerator attempts to physically repair the damage.
